The Diamond Systems Ruby-MM-812-XT is a PC/104 analog output module delivering 8 channels of 12-bit D/A conversion paired with 24 CMOS/TTL-compatible digital I/O lines. Built for embedded and industrial systems operating in demanding temperature environments, this compact board generates precise analog signals across multiple voltage ranges while providing flexible digital control in a single 90mm × 96mm form factor.
## Technical Specifications
**Analog Output**
• 8 channels, 12-bit resolution (1 part in 4096)
• DAC8412 quad converter architecture
• Output ranges: 0–2.5V, 0–5V, 0–10V (unipolar); ±2.5V, ±5V, ±10V (bipolar)
• 5 mA sourcing/sinking per channel simultaneously
• 6 µS maximum settling time to 0.01%
• ±1 LSB relative accuracy
• 2 kΩ minimum load impedance
• Simultaneous update via software or external trigger
• Power-on reset to mid-scale (0V for bipolar; half full-scale for unipolar)
• User-adjustable preset range: 1V to 2.5V full-scale
• All 8 outputs share single jumper-configured range
**Digital I/O**
• 24 lines via 82C55 controller
• Logic 0 input: −0.5V to 0.8V
• Logic 1 input: 2.0V to 5.5V
• Logic 0 output: 0.0V to 0.4V
• Logic 1 output: 3.0V to 4.6V
• ±2.5 mA per line output current
• 10 kΩ pull-up resistors on all I/O lines
**Electrical**
• +5 VDC ±10% from PC/104 bus
• 290 mA typical power draw
• On-board ±15V supply generation from +5VDC input
## Key Features
• Single 50-pin connector for user I/O with standard 0.1″ ribbon cable compatibility
• PC/104 8-bit bus interface; 16-bit connector not utilized
• Operating temperature: −40°C to +85°C
• Weight: 76 g; dimensions 90mm × 96mm
